﻿@import"https://fonts.googleapis.com/css2?family=Gloock&family=League+Spartan:wght@100..900&family=Noto+Sans+JP:wght@100..900&display=swap";.pane-content{max-width:100%;padding-top:0}.pane-content *{box-sizing:border-box}.pane-content>:last-child{margin-bottom:0}@media screen and (max-width: 767px){.pane-main{padding-left:0;padding-right:0}}.only-sp{display:none}@media screen and (max-width: 767px){.only-pc{display:none}.only-sp{display:block}}.anniv5cp .section-header{font-size:28px;font-weight:700;text-align:center;margin:0 0 30px}@media screen and (max-width: 767px){.anniv5cp .section-header{font-size:18px;margin-bottom:22px}}.anniv5cp-mv{--color-bg: #F8F4E4;position:relative;padding-bottom:30px;overflow:hidden;background:var(--color-bg, #CCC)}.anniv5cp-mv-logo{position:absolute;top:20px;right:20px}.anniv5cp-mv-logo img{display:block;width:126px;height:11px}@media screen and (max-width: 767px){.anniv5cp-mv-logo{top:10px;right:10px}.anniv5cp-mv-logo img{width:79px;height:7px}}.anniv5cp-header{background:#f05456;padding-top:60px;position:relative;top:-100px;display:flex;justify-content:center}.anniv5cp-header picture{display:block;transform:translateY(120px)}.anniv5cp-header img{display:block;width:990px;max-width:100%;margin:0 auto;aspect-ratio:990/390}@media screen and (max-width: 767px){.anniv5cp-header{padding-top:0;top:-20px}.anniv5cp-header picture{transform:translateY(40px)}.anniv5cp-header img{width:100%;aspect-ratio:154/150}}.anniv5cp-index{--color-prize: #F05456;--color-bg: #F8F4E4;background:var(--color-bg, #F8F4E4)}.anniv5cp-index-inner{width:800px;margin:0 auto}.anniv5cp-index-list{display:flex;justify-content:center}.anniv5cp-index-list-item{width:320px;margin:0 10px}.anniv5cp-index-list-item-a{--color-prize: #F05456}.anniv5cp-index-list-item-b{--color-prize: #14305B}.anniv5cp-index-list-item a{display:block;padding:20px 10px 40px;text-align:center;line-height:1.3;background:#fff;border-radius:10px;border:1px solid #e5e5e5;text-decoration:none;position:relative}.anniv5cp-index-list-item a:hover{opacity:.9}.anniv5cp-index-list-item a::after{content:"";display:block;position:absolute;bottom:15px;left:50%;transform:translateX(-50%) rotate(45deg);width:7px;height:7px;border-right:1.5px solid #000;border-bottom:1.5px solid #000}.anniv5cp-index-list-item .prize-badge{position:absolute;top:10px;left:10px;color:#fff;background:var(--color-prize, #FFF);width:64px;height:64px;border-radius:50%;font-size:20px;font-weight:700;display:flex;justify-content:center;align-items:center}.anniv5cp-index-list-item-img{display:block}.anniv5cp-index-list-item-img img{display:block;margin:0 auto 12px;width:72px;height:72px}.anniv5cp-index-list-item-name{color:#000;font-size:16px;font-weight:500}.anniv5cp-index-list-item-products{color:#494949;font-size:14px;font-weight:500;margin-top:5px}.anniv5cp-index-list-item-note{color:#494949;font-size:10px;font-weight:500;text-align:right;margin-top:5px}@media screen and (max-width: 767px){.anniv5cp-index-inner{width:auto;margin:0 22px}.anniv5cp-index-list{width:100%;justify-content:space-between}.anniv5cp-index-list-item{width:calc(50% - 5px);margin:0}.anniv5cp-index-list-item a{padding:6px 6px 30px}.anniv5cp-index-list-item .prize-badge{position:absolute;top:6px;left:6px;width:46px;height:46px}.anniv5cp-index-list-item-img{display:block}.anniv5cp-index-list-item-img img{display:block;margin:0 auto 12px;width:52px;height:52px}.anniv5cp-index-list-item-name{font-size:12px}.anniv5cp-index-list-item-products{font-size:8px}.anniv5cp-index-list-item-note{font-size:8px;letter-spacing:-0.1em}}.anniv5cp-prize-b-container+.anniv5cp-index{--color-bg: #FFF;padding-bottom:60px}.anniv5cp-prize-b-container+.anniv5cp-index .anniv5cp-index-list-item a::after{transform:translateX(-50%) rotate(225deg)}.anniv5cp-prize{background:var(--color-bg, #FFF)}.anniv5cp-prize-a-container{--color-prize: #F05456;--color-bg: #F8F4E4}.anniv5cp-prize-b-container{--color-prize: #14305B;--color-bg: #FFF}.anniv5cp-prize-inner{width:800px;padding:40px 0;margin:0 auto;border-bottom:1px solid #e5e5e5}.anniv5cp-prize-header{display:flex;justify-content:center;align-items:center;height:50px;color:#fff;background:var(--color-prize, #999);font-size:28px;margin:0 15px 40px;position:relative}.anniv5cp-prize-header::before,.anniv5cp-prize-header::after{content:"";display:block;position:absolute;top:0;width:0;height:0;border:25px solid var(--color-prize)}.anniv5cp-prize-header::before{left:-15px;border-left:15px solid rgba(0,0,0,0)}.anniv5cp-prize-header::after{right:-15px;border-right:15px solid rgba(0,0,0,0)}.anniv5cp-prize-contents{display:flex;flex-direction:row-reverse}.anniv5cp-prize-img{width:400px;flex-shrink:0;margin-right:38px;border-radius:20px;overflow:hidden;position:relative}.anniv5cp-prize-img img{display:block;width:400px;height:400px;aspect-ratio:1}.anniv5cp-prize-img .prize-badge{position:absolute;bottom:46px;right:20px;width:84px;height:84px;display:flex;flex-direction:column;justify-content:center;align-items:center;color:#f8f4e4;background:var(--color-prize);border-radius:50%;font-size:13px;font-family:"League Spartan",sans-serif;font-weight:700;line-height:1;padding-bottom:2px;z-index:10}.anniv5cp-prize-img .prize-badge .num{font-size:46px;position:relative;top:5px}.anniv5cp-prize-img .prize-badge .text-lottery{position:absolute;top:-15px;left:-10px;width:45px;height:32px}.anniv5cp-prize-img-list-item{border-radius:20px;overflow:hidden}.anniv5cp-prize-img-caption{position:absolute;bottom:30px;right:10px;color:#fff;font-size:10px;z-index:10}.anniv5cp-prize-title{font-size:24px;font-weight:700;margin-bottom:20px}.anniv5cp-prize-title .sub{font-size:16px;margin-bottom:10px}.anniv5cp-prize-title .main+.sub{margin-top:10px}.anniv5cp-prize-title .main{letter-spacing:.04em}.anniv5cp-prize-text{font-size:16px;font-weight:500;line-height:1.5;margin-bottom:10px}.anniv5cp-prize-text .ruby{font-size:.8em;position:relative;top:-3px}.anniv5cp-prize-note-item{font-size:14px;line-height:1.7;margin-left:1em;text-indent:-1em}.anniv5cp-prize-note-item::before{content:"※"}.anniv5cp-prize-product{margin-top:30px;padding-top:30px;border-top:1px solid #e5e5e5}.anniv5cp-prize-product-header{font-size:20px;font-weight:700;margin-bottom:20px}.anniv5cp-prize-product-list{display:flex;align-items:baseline}.anniv5cp-prize-product-list-item{font-size:16px;font-weight:500}.anniv5cp-prize-product-list-item a{text-decoration:underline}.anniv5cp-prize-product-list-item a:hover{text-decoration:none}.anniv5cp-prize-product-list-item-note{font-size:12px;margin-top:10px}.anniv5cp-prize-product-list-item-note::before{content:"※"}.anniv5cp-prize-product-list-item+.anniv5cp-prize-product-list-item::before{content:"・"}@media screen and (max-width: 767px){.anniv5cp-prize-inner{width:auto;margin:0 22px}.anniv5cp-prize-header{height:32px;font-size:14px;margin:0 30px 20px}.anniv5cp-prize-header::before,.anniv5cp-prize-header::after{border:16px solid var(--color-prize)}.anniv5cp-prize-header::before{left:-10px;border-left:10px solid rgba(0,0,0,0)}.anniv5cp-prize-header::after{right:-10px;border-right:10px solid rgba(0,0,0,0)}.anniv5cp-prize-contents{display:block}.anniv5cp-prize-img{width:235px;margin:0 auto 20px}.anniv5cp-prize-img img{width:235px;height:235px;aspect-ratio:1}.anniv5cp-prize-img .prize-badge{bottom:46px;right:10px;width:50px;height:50px;font-size:8px}.anniv5cp-prize-img .prize-badge .num{font-size:28px;top:2px}.anniv5cp-prize-img .prize-badge .text-lottery{top:-15px;left:-8px;width:30px}.anniv5cp-prize-title{font-size:18px;letter-spacing:normal;margin-bottom:20px;text-align:center}.anniv5cp-prize-title .sub{font-size:12px;margin-bottom:10px}.anniv5cp-prize-title .main+.sub{margin-top:10px}.anniv5cp-prize-text{font-size:12px;text-align:center}.anniv5cp-prize-note-item{font-size:10px;text-align:center}.anniv5cp-prize-product{margin:0 auto 20px;padding-top:0;border:none}.anniv5cp-prize-product-header{font-size:14px;margin-bottom:10px;display:flex;align-items:center;text-align:center}.anniv5cp-prize-product-header::before,.anniv5cp-prize-product-header::after{content:"";height:1px;border-top:1px solid #e5e5e5;flex-grow:1}.anniv5cp-prize-product-header::before{margin-right:12px}.anniv5cp-prize-product-header::after{margin-left:12px}.anniv5cp-prize-product-list{justify-content:center}.anniv5cp-prize-product-list-item{font-size:14px}.anniv5cp-prize-product-list-item-note{font-size:8px}}.anniv5cp-item-list{background:var(--color-bg, #F8F4E4)}.anniv5cp-item-list-wrapper{position:relative;overflow:hidden;width:100%;margin-top:-30px}.anniv5cp-item-list-inner{width:800px;padding:40px 0;margin:0 auto}.anniv5cp-item-list-slider-container{position:relative}.anniv5cp-item-list-slider-btn{margin-top:30px;text-align:center}.anniv5cp-item-list .items{flex-wrap:nowrap;justify-content:flex-start;gap:0}.anniv5cp-item-list .item{width:188px;margin:0}.anniv5cp-item-list .item-list-wrapper{overflow:hidden}.anniv5cp-item-list .swiper-button-prev,.anniv5cp-item-list .swiper-button-next{width:40px;height:40px;position:absolute;top:50%;background:none;z-index:100}@media screen and (max-width: 767px){.anniv5cp-item-list-inner{width:auto;margin:0;padding:30px 0}.anniv5cp-item-list-slider-container .item-list-wrapper{padding:0}.anniv5cp-item-list-slider-container .item-list-wrapper .items-sp-horizontal{overflow:visible}}.anniv5cp-recommended{background:var(--color-bg, #F8F4E4)}.anniv5cp-recommended-enbudaki .anniv5cp-recommended-inner{border-bottom:1px solid #e5e5e5}.anniv5cp-recommended-everino .anniv5cp-recommended-name{color:#000}.anniv5cp-recommended-inner{width:800px;padding:40px 0;margin:0 auto}.anniv5cp-recommended-contents{border-radius:42px;overflow:hidden}.anniv5cp-recommended-img{position:relative}.anniv5cp-recommended-img img{width:100%;aspect-ratio:670/400}.anniv5cp-recommended-name{position:absolute;bottom:40px;left:50%;transform:translateX(-50%);display:block;color:#fff;font-size:20px;font-weight:700;text-align:center}.anniv5cp-recommended-list{display:flex}.anniv5cp-recommended-list-wrapper{background:#fff;padding:40px 24px 56px 56px;position:relative}.anniv5cp-recommended-list-item{width:calc(33.3333333333% - 32px);margin-right:32px}.anniv5cp-recommended-list-item-header{display:flex;align-items:center;margin-bottom:10px}.anniv5cp-recommended-list-item-header-icon{margin-right:5px;flex-shrink:0}.anniv5cp-recommended-list-item-header-icon img{display:block;width:48px;height:60px}.anniv5cp-recommended-list-item-header-icon img[src*="icon_person06.svg"]{width:72px}.anniv5cp-recommended-list-item-header-text{font-size:14px;font-weight:500;line-height:1.4;letter-spacing:-0.04em;margin-right:-20px}.anniv5cp-recommended-list-item-img{margin-bottom:23px;border-radius:10px;overflow:hidden}.anniv5cp-recommended-list-item-img img{display:block;width:100%;aspect-ratio:1}.anniv5cp-recommended-list-item-text{font-size:14px;font-weight:400;line-height:1.5}.anniv5cp-recommended-list-item-text .nowrap{white-space:nowrap}.anniv5cp-recommended-list-item-text .ruby{font-size:.8em;position:relative;top:-3px}.anniv5cp-recommended-list-item-text-note{color:#494949;font-size:12px}@media screen and (max-width: 767px){.anniv5cp-recommended .section-header{font-size:16px}.anniv5cp-recommended-inner{width:auto;margin:0 22px;padding:30px 0}.anniv5cp-recommended-contents{border-radius:20px}.anniv5cp-recommended-name{bottom:13px;font-size:14px;width:100%}.anniv5cp-recommended-list-wrapper{padding:26px 0 20px}.anniv5cp-recommended-list-item{width:100%;padding:0 20px;margin:0;flex-shrink:0}.anniv5cp-recommended-list-item-content{display:flex}.anniv5cp-recommended-list-item-img{margin:0 20px 0 0;flex-shrink:0}.anniv5cp-recommended-list-item-img img{width:120px;height:120px}.anniv5cp-recommended-list-item-text{font-size:12px}.anniv5cp-recommended .swiper-dots{display:flex;justify-content:center;margin-top:10px}.anniv5cp-recommended .swiper-dots .swiper-pagination-bullet{width:12px;height:12px;border-radius:50%;background:#d9d9d9;margin:0 5px}.anniv5cp-recommended .swiper-dots .swiper-pagination-bullet-active{background:var(--color-prize)}}.anniv5cp-search-inner{width:800px;padding:40px 0;margin:0 auto}.anniv5cp-search-header{font-size:21px;font-weight:500;margin-bottom:22px}.anniv5cp-search-form{position:relative;width:394px}.anniv5cp-search input[type=text]{width:100%;height:50px;border-radius:25px;padding:0 20px}.anniv5cp-search-btn{position:absolute;top:0;right:0;display:flex;justify-content:center;align-items:center;width:50px;height:50px;border:none;background:none}.anniv5cp-search-btn .icon{width:18px;height:18px}@media screen and (max-width: 767px){.anniv5cp-search-inner{width:auto;margin:0 22px;padding:30px 0}.anniv5cp-search-header{font-size:14px;margin-bottom:20px}.anniv5cp-search-form{width:295px}.anniv5cp-search input[type=text]{height:40px;border-radius:20px;padding:0 12px;font-size:12px}.anniv5cp-search-btn{width:40px;height:40px}.anniv5cp-search-btn .icon{width:14px;height:14px}}.anniv5cp-ranking-inner{width:800px;padding:40px 0;margin:0 auto}.anniv5cp-ranking-header{font-size:21px;font-weight:500;margin-bottom:22px}.anniv5cp-ranking-btn{margin-top:30px;text-align:center}.anniv5cp-ranking .items-ranking-link-list-item{margin-right:4px}.anniv5cp-ranking .items-ranking-link-list-item a{padding:10px 12px}.anniv5cp-ranking .items-ranking-section{display:none;-webkit-text-size-adjust:100%;text-size-adjust:100%}.anniv5cp-ranking .items-ranking-section.is_current{display:block}.anniv5cp-ranking .items{gap:10px;flex-wrap:wrap;-webkit-text-size-adjust:100%;text-size-adjust:100%}.anniv5cp-ranking .items .item{width:calc(20% - 10px);flex-shrink:0;-webkit-text-size-adjust:100%;text-size-adjust:100%}.anniv5cp-ranking .items .item-name{font-size:16px}.anniv5cp-ranking .items .item-comment{font-size:14px}@media screen and (max-width: 767px){.anniv5cp-ranking-inner{width:auto;padding:30px 0}.anniv5cp-ranking-header{font-size:14px;margin:0 22px 20px}.anniv5cp-ranking .items-ranking-link-list{margin:0 22px}.anniv5cp-ranking .items-ranking-section{overflow:hidden}.anniv5cp-ranking .items{display:flex;flex-wrap:nowrap;gap:0}.anniv5cp-ranking .items .item{width:auto}.anniv5cp-ranking .items .item-name{font-size:14px}.anniv5cp-ranking .items .item-comment{font-size:12px}}.anniv5cp-kiyaku{--color-bg: #F8F4E4;background:var(--color-bg, #F8F4E4)}.anniv5cp-kiyaku-inner{width:800px;padding:40px 0;margin:0 auto}.anniv5cp-kiyaku-header{color:#14305b;font-size:28px;font-weight:700;margin-bottom:22px;text-align:center}.anniv5cp-kiyaku-content-wrapper{font-size:12px;line-height:1.8}.anniv5cp-kiyaku-p{margin-bottom:1em}.anniv5cp-kiyaku-dl{margin-top:1em}.anniv5cp-kiyaku-label{font-size:14px;font-weight:500}.anniv5cp-kiyaku-note-item{margin-left:1em;text-indent:-1em}.anniv5cp-kiyaku-note-item::before{content:"※"}.anniv5cp-kiyaku-caution-label{font-size:14px;font-weight:500}.anniv5cp-kiyaku-caution-label::before{content:"〈"}.anniv5cp-kiyaku-caution-label::after{content:"〉"}.anniv5cp-kiyaku-caution-list-item{margin-left:1em;text-indent:-1em}.anniv5cp-kiyaku-caution-list-item::before{content:"・"}@media screen and (max-width: 767px){.anniv5cp-kiyaku-inner{width:auto;margin:0 22px;padding:32px 0}.anniv5cp-kiyaku-header{font-size:16px;margin-bottom:20px}.anniv5cp-kiyaku-content-wrapper{font-size:10px}.anniv5cp-kiyaku-label{font-size:12px}.anniv5cp-kiyaku-caution-label{font-size:12px}}.anniv5cp .swiper-button-prev,.anniv5cp .swiper-button-next{position:absolute;width:32px;height:32px;background:#444;border-radius:999px;box-shadow:0 0 12px 0 rgba(0,0,0,.12);z-index:100;cursor:pointer}.anniv5cp .swiper-button-prev::after,.anniv5cp .swiper-button-next::after{content:"";display:block;position:absolute;top:50%;width:8px;height:8px;border-left:2px solid #fff;border-bottom:2px solid #fff}@media screen and (max-width: 767px){.anniv5cp .swiper-button-prev,.anniv5cp .swiper-button-next{display:none}}.anniv5cp .swiper-button-prev{left:-16px}.anniv5cp .swiper-button-prev::after{left:14px;transform:translateY(-50%) rotate(45deg)}.anniv5cp .swiper-button-next{right:-16px}.anniv5cp .swiper-button-next::after{right:14px;transform:translateY(-50%) rotate(225deg)}.anniv5cp .swiper-dots{display:flex;justify-content:center;margin-top:10px}.anniv5cp .swiper-dots .swiper-pagination-bullet{width:12px;height:12px;border-radius:50%;background:#d9d9d9;margin:0 5px}.anniv5cp .swiper-dots .swiper-pagination-bullet-active{background:var(--color-prize)}